United Airlines mishandled listeria contamination, endangering travellers, lawsuits claim

United Airlines failed to address critical food safety issues at Newark Liberty International, endangered passengers and retaliated against employees for speaking up, 3 high-level managers who worked in its catering division allege in lawsuits filed last month. United further engaged in a pattern of disregard for food safety and attempted to cover up problems, according to the lawsuits by United's former senior manager of food safety, the GM of the Newark catering facility, and a Newark food safety manager. United denied the allegations and said the lawsuits were without merit. "Everyone at United Airlines…is committed to serving our customers the safest and highest quality food in the air," it said. Additionally, United said it is unaware of any foodborne illnesses confirmed to be linked to any food served on its flights. <br/>
